5 out of 5 stars BUY THIS ALBUM YOU WONT REGRET IT.......2002-08-18

bas-1 is not only a talented lyricist, electric performer, and hard worker, he is an example of what makes the Bay Area one of the most talent-ridden areas in the U.S. He is also from North Oakland and is a "real" conscious MC. Instead of droppin' 15 bucks for that Jay-Z, Ja Rule or (Type overhyped, commercial, Pepsi-ad-doin' MC here), do yourself a favor and pick up this album.
